Trip to Basement Discs

Come to Melbourne and wander through crowded Block Place, tucked away off Little Collins Street, to a door leading downstairs into the cavernous, welcoming record store (I still call it that) Basement Discs. Quality music within unfashionable categories, the finest of advice, regular free lunchtime live acts, an excellent New Releases section, and a palpable love of music . . . surely this is heaven.

The best time to visit Basement Discs is after a boozy lunch. Here’s what I found today:

  • Eric Bogle’s The Dreamer – apparently he’s saying it’s his last album!
  • Patrick Wolf’s The Bachelor
  • Untitled #23by The Church – just as I’m processing Kilbey’s solo album, this one almost sneaks past me
